Idioms are untranslatable because they reference things in the languages native culture, if you have no experience with that then ofc you'll be confused about the result. Also wdym why can't you say word in a certain way, languages have rules for a reason, people wouldnt understand each other very well if it was an everything goes situation. As someone who is learning 2 languages that aren't English atm the key with language is to focus on the meaning behind the words and phrases rather than the content within them, ie bain an chluas díom (take the ear off me) makes little sense when you don't have the context it means trust me in English, you just have to start focusing on meaning over word content and you'll find greater success. Also generally don't worry about not being perfect immediately, language learning takes time, effort and an open mind

As for grammar, each language has the same underlying systems, what differs is how those pieces fit together and even if they're marked, so if we compare "bain an chluas díom makes little sense when you don't have the context it means trust me in English" to "Ní bhaineann mórán céille leis an fhrása "bain an chluas díom" nuair nach bhfuil an comhthéacs agat gurb í "trust me" an bhrí a bhaineann leis" you can see that the order in the foreign language is verb first followed by the subject and then object. Much sense is mórán céille, ciall the word for sense is in the genitive case so it becomes céille to show it's related to mórán. Frása is there to tag a gender onto the cited phrase so it gels better with the conversation in case I need to reference it later, which I will. Nach bhfuil is a special form (specifically of the word níl which means is not) used to show that "nuair" (when) and "an comhthéacs" (the context) are linked by the verb rather than being separate in the conversation, think of it as an anti comma, something that shows the words after it aren't part of a new clause (basically a segment of a sentence, we divide them with commas in English). Agat means at you (singular) and in the context of the sentence makes it so that other people know it's not that the context doesn't exist it's just that some people might not have it. Gurb í means "that she is" in the sense "The context that she is <phrase> its meaning" (Remember verb first so gurb is that-is) and we use the feminine pronoun í to tie the phrase op the next noun which is going to be feminine, again handy for when you want to be specific about which it you're talking about. The h in an bhrí shows brí is feminine (it's not just a spelling thing btw it changes brí from sounding like bree to sounding like vree) the purpose of which isn't best visible here but basically it shows which gender you should refer to it as if you want to comment on it in future. A bhaineann leis means "that corresponds to it" in the sense of "the meaning that corresponds to it" you use a over go (the "free" version of gurb that can connect to verbs that aren't irregular) here because we aren't changing what thing is doing the action unlike you would in the sentence "when you have the context that it is X that is the meaning here" (it being bold to show that's the point where you're changing subject) and finally we're using leis to reference frása which is a masculine noun so we're using the masculine form of with.

Hopefully that shows you language stuff can be pretty logical sometimes
